IIS6 Windows Server 2003 - 不会运行某些.exe程序,而其他人则会运行.exe程序

时间:2016-08-03 15:02:00

标签: windows vbscript asp-classic server iis-6

正如我在标题中所述。我正在研究一些旧仪器。我使用Windows Server 2003和经典的asp制作东西(不要问为什么......)。

我正在使用

   set objectShell = CreateObject("WScript.Shell")   
   objectShell.Run "cmd /c" & command,1,true

当命令将是.exe文件并且可能是一些参数。 现在这适用于我需要的几个没有GUI的.exe程序。 我有1个需要GUI的.exe,当我运行这段代码时,我看不到服务器打开它,我也没有收到任何错误。

  • 当我在CMD中运行此命令而没有使用asp文件时(gui打开并关闭而不需要交互。它只是因为某种原因必须打开它。)
  • 当我尝试从服务器asp运行notepad.exe时,它会弹出GUI。

这两种情况都让我对找什么感到困惑,而且我很长时间都找不到任何东西。

也很重要

  • 我在计算机上的VMware上运行Windows Server 2003并启用了WWW服务,因此当我尝试在计算机上进行Web时,我可以看到服务器的响应。

    任何帮助将不胜感激。

0 个答案:

没有答案